if you look at the caliper you will see 2 small holes on the side one top and one bottom hole (brake pad side).....what you need to do is align the pads and skims then insert one pin in the top hole and through skims and pads until it wont go any further then insert the clip on the other side of the pin(small hole in the pin for this) so it dont come out.....then align bottom holes up and insert the other pin and clip.....if you get a pair of pliers you will be able to pull or push the pads for the holes to allign to make it easier to insert the pins :thumbsup:
